【第1回】WSL2にUbuntu 22.04 LTSを導入する

はじめに

WSL2にUbuntu 22.04 LTSを導入してみました。
「22.04」のナンバリングは2022年4月に公開されたことを表しています。
つまり出たばかりです。

2022年4月23日現在コマンドプロンプト上で「wsl -l --online」と入力してもUbuntu 22.04は出てきません。

D:\>wsl -l --online
インストールできる有効なディストリビューションの一覧を次に示します。
'wsl.exe --install <Distro>' を使用してインストールします。

NAME               FRIENDLY NAME
Ubuntu             Ubuntu
Debian             Debian GNU/Linux
kali-linux         Kali Linux Rolling
openSUSE-42        openSUSE Leap 42
SLES-12            SUSE Linux Enterprise Server v12
SLES-15            SUSE Linux Enterprise Server v15
Ubuntu-18.04       Ubuntu 18.04 LTS
Ubuntu-20.04       Ubuntu 20.04 LTS
OracleLinux_8_5    Oracle Linux 8.5
OracleLinux_7_9    Oracle Linux 7.9

Microsoft Storeに行くとダウンロードできます。

設定

設定するための画面が3つ出てきます。

言語設定

言語選択ができるようですがいきなり文字化けしています。

そのまま次にすすむと日本語の設定になりました。


インストール後に「sudo apt update」を実行した時の画面を載せておきます。
日本語に設定されているのがわかります。

hoge@DESKTOP-PKEQVVM:~$ sudo apt update
[sudo] hoge のパスワード:
ヒット:1 http://archive.ubuntu.com/ubuntu jammy InRelease
ヒット:2 http://security.ubuntu.com/ubuntu jammy-security InRelease
ヒット:3 http://archive.ubuntu.com/ubuntu jammy-updates InRelease
ヒット:4 http://archive.ubuntu.com/ubuntu jammy-backports InRelease
取得:5 http://archive.ubuntu.com/ubuntu jammy/main Translation-ja [295 kB]
取得:6 http://archive.ubuntu.com/ubuntu jammy/universe Translation-ja [1,534 kB]
取得:7 http://archive.ubuntu.com/ubuntu jammy/multiverse Translation-ja [7,160 B]
1,837 kB を 3秒 で取得しました (592 kB/s)
パッケージリストを読み込んでいます... 完了
依存関係ツリーを作成しています... 完了
状態情報を読み取っています... 完了
パッケージはすべて最新です。

ユーザーネーム、パスワードの設定


Your nameのところには最初Microsoftアカウント名が入っていました。
文字化けしていたのですがコピーしてメモ帳に貼り付けたらそうだとわかりました。


この部分は後に必要になるのかどうかわかりません。空欄にしてもお咎めなく次にすすめました。


usernameとpasswordは任意に入力します。

mountに関する設定


ここはよくわからなかったのでそのまま次にすすみました。

結果

これで問題なくインストール完了です。

hoge@DESKTOP-PKEQVVM:~$ cat /etc/os-release
PRETTY_NAME="Ubuntu 22.04 LTS"
NAME="Ubuntu"
VERSION_ID="22.04"
VERSION="22.04 (Jammy Jellyfish)"
VERSION_CODENAME=jammy
ID=ubuntu
ID_LIKE=debian
HOME_URL="https://www.ubuntu.com/"
SUPPORT_URL="https://help.ubuntu.com/"
BUG_REPORT_URL="https://bugs.launchpad.net/ubuntu/"
PRIVACY_POLICY_URL="https://www.ubuntu.com/legal/terms-and-policies/privacy-policy"
UBUNTU_CODENAME=jammy

後から言語を変更する

日本語設定にしたくなかったのにそうなってしまいました。
以下の手順で後から英語に変更しました。

hoge@DESKTOP-PKEQVVM:~$ sudo apt install language-pack-en
hoge@DESKTOP-PKEQVVM:~$ sudo update-locale LANG=en_US.UTF-8

記事一覧

「WSL2にUbuntu 22.04 LTSを導入する」シリーズの記事一覧はこちら